Ryan Newman
Let’s see…the number 12 Penske Dodge of Ryan Newman finished the 2007 season without a single win, but with 9 top ten finishes. Not great…but not totally awful, either. He even managed to squeak out two top fives. But what does that say about this driver, who has 12 career wins and 98 (count ‘em!) top tens?
Well…I don’t have a lot of faith in Newman this year either. In 2003, his average finish was 6.7. In 2007, it was 13.8. Ouch. Talk about slippage! Unfortunately, I think that trend is set to continue. I’m not as optimistic for Newman as I was about Sadler and McMurry yesterday - for Ryan, I foresee a finish no higher than 17th in the 2008 season. I just don’t see that his team has made any super positive changes to put him in a better position for 2008. Sorry, Ryan!
Greg Biffle
I’m much more optimistic for Greg Biffle for 2008. After a lackluster showing in 2007 that still managed to a nice win and six top tens, I think Biffle’s star is on the rise in 2008. Also a Roush Fenway driver, the #16 Dodge is driven by a man with a lot of heart - and that heart will propel him to the top in 2008.
But why? Well, other than just being the opinion of your favorite NASCAR blogger, Biffle has been a part of his team for more than ten years now, and although he has been super victorious in Busch and Truck, has experienced some major growing pains and inconsistent output in Cup. I think 2008 is the year that will end - with the right combination of a fabulous team, a good driver, and just a little bit of luck, I predict a top ten finish for Greg Biffle in 2008.
